Florence
Florence is a city that is rich in history and culture. It’s home to some of the most famous works of art in the world, including Michelangelo’s David and Botticelli’s The Birth of Venus. Additionally, the city is known for its delicious food and wine, making it an all-around delightful destination.
Venice
Venice is a city that is unlike any other in the world. Its canals, bridges, and narrow streets give it a romantic and mysterious vibe. Visitors can take a gondola ride, visit St. Mark’s Basilica, and explore the city’s many shops and restaurants.
FAQs About The Map Of Italy
Q: What is the best time of year to visit Italy?
A: The best time to visit Italy depends on your preferences. If you want to avoid crowds and enjoy cooler weather, consider traveling in the fall or winter. If you prefer warmer temperatures and longer days, the summer months are ideal.
Q: Do I need a visa to visit Italy?
A: It depends on your country of origin. Citizens of the US, Canada, and many European countries do not need a visa for stays of up to 90 days. Check with the Italian embassy in your country for more information.
Q: What is the currency of Italy?
A: The currency of Italy is the Euro.
Q: What is the official language of Italy?
A: The official language of Italy is Italian.
